Traditional Real Estate Market Analysis In A Digital Age

Real estate market analysis traditionally relies on key metrics such as property values, rental yields, occupancy rates, and demographic trends. The introduction of cryptocurrency adds new dimensions to this analysis. Property valuations must now consider the potential impact of cryptocurrency market conditions, particularly in markets where digital asset wealth has created new buyer demographics.

Market analysts have observed correlations between cryptocurrency bull runs and increased luxury real estate activity in major metropolitan areas. This phenomenon necessitates a more nuanced approach to market analysis, incorporating cryptocurrency market cycles into traditional real estate forecasting models.

Cryptocurrency’s Impact On Real Estate Transactions

The integration of cryptocurrency into real estate transactions has created new considerations for market analysis. Properties listed with cryptocurrency payment options often demonstrate different market dynamics compared to traditional listings. These properties may experience increased international buyer interest and faster transaction times, though they may also face additional scrutiny from financial institutions and regulators.

Transaction analysis must now account for cryptocurrency volatility when properties are priced in digital assets. This has led to the development of new pricing models that incorporate both fiat and cryptocurrency valuations, often with sophisticated hedging strategies to protect against market fluctuations.

Real Estate Tokenization: A New Market Paradigm

Real estate tokenisation represents the most significant convergence of these markets. By fractionalising property ownership through blockchain technology, tokenisation creates new investment opportunities and market dynamics that require sophisticated analysis.

Market analysts must now evaluate factors such as token liquidity, smart contract security, and regulatory compliance alongside traditional real estate metrics. The success of tokenised properties often depends on both the underlying real estate fundamentals and the structure of the tokenisation platform.

Regulatory Considerations In Market Analysis

The regulatory environment significantly influences both real estate and cryptocurrency markets. The analysis must account for evolving regulations in both sectors, particularly regarding the following:

  • Anti-money laundering (AML) requirements
  • Know Your Customer (KYC) protocols
  • International transaction regulations
  • Property ownership laws concerning digital assets

Understanding these regulatory frameworks becomes crucial for accurate market analysis and risk assessment.
